+

1PCS French Crouzet 83261 83261071 high current stroke reset press micro switch, curved foot 16A

USD 9.89USD 11.11

1PCS French Crouzet 83261 83261071 high current stroke reset press micro switch, curved foot 16A

Description
Specification
+